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Falkirk High to West Ruislip start from £100.50 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Falkirk High to West Ruislip are available for £212.90 one way

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ities at Falkirk High

Falkirk High station is equipped with several essential facilities to ensure a smooth and convenient journey. For ticket purchases, the ticket office is open Monday to Saturday from 6:30 AM to 8:22 PM, and on Sunday from 8:10 AM to 3:50 PM. The station also provides ticket machines, accessible ticket machines, and features like induction loops to assist those with hearing impairments.

The station boasts step-free access to parts of the station, however, presents challenges like a steeper incline on platform 2. Thus, passengers with mobility issues should be cautious. There are 4 Blue Badge parking bays available, and the car park operated by ScotRail offers abundant space with 203 slots.

Refreshments are not left out as a mobile coffee van is available to ensure you're well-fueled before your travel. While there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ities currently, you can find toilets during the ticket office opening hours.

Connecting You Onwards

Getting to and from Falkirk High is straightforward with several transportation links. Bus services pick up and drop off passengers just outside the station's booking office. For detailed bus service information, you might want to visit Traveline Scotland or call their 24-hour service. Additionally, taxis can be hired through resources such as Train Taxi.

In cases where rail services are disrupted, a rail replacement bus service operates from the turning circle outside Platform 1, ensuring passengers can continue their journeys with minimal fuss.

Facilities and Amenities

West Ruislip train station offers several essential facilities for ticket buying and collection. While it does not have a ticket office, ticket machines are available for collecting pre-purchased tickets, including an accessible machine on Platform 4. Additionally, the station offers an induction loop for those who need it, although it has no smartcard issuance or validation capabilities.

The station provides staff help from early in the morning until late at night, ensuring travelers can always find assistance if needed. Despite the absence of luggage storage, waiting rooms, and toilets, the station is equipped with CCTV, enhancing passenger security. If you're planning a prolonged stay, however, it might be worth noting the lack of refreshment facilities, shops, or Wi-Fi, so come prepared with your own essentials.

Accessibility and Supporting Services

For passengers requiring accessibility support, it's essential to know that step-free access at West Ruislip is available only between the main car park and Chiltern Railways Platform 4, headed towards Marylebone or West Ealing. Unfortunately, this means there is no step-free access to northbound services or London Underground trains from this station. Accessible ticket machines and ramps are in place to aid those needing them, but no accessible taxis or drop-off points are available in the vicinity.

Onward Travel Options

West Ruislip provides several onward travel options, catering to a range of commuting needs. Rail replacement services by Chiltern Railways can be accessed from the main station car park, while London Underground replacement buses stop conveniently outside the station. Regular local bus services, including routes 278, U1, and U10, are also available right from the front entrance of the station, providing easy access to the surrounding areas.
